Top growth suburbs by median property prices – December 2024

Top growth suburbs over the last three month period ending 31 December 2024.

With interest rates remaining elevated, there is growing optimism that recent inflation data may prompt the Reserve Bank of Australia (RBA) to consider a rate cut in the coming quarter. Such a move could provide much-needed relief to borrowers and stimulate further activity in the property market.

Over the past three months, Melbourne’s property market has demonstrated resilience, with twelve suburbs recording double-digit growth in house median prices and sixteen suburbs experiencing similar gains in unit prices. This strong performance highlights the ongoing demand for property in key growth areas, driven by factors such as population growth, infrastructure investment, and changing buyer preferences.

Here we share the latest quarterly figures within the Melbourne property market.

Is Now a Good Time to Buy?

Deciding whether to enter the market depends on a range of personal and financial factors. While some buyers may be cautious given current interest rates, others see opportunities in areas that are showing strong capital growth potential. Investors and owner-occupiers alike are assessing Melbourne’s long-term fundamentals, including affordability, rental demand, and future price projections.
